The Importance of Air Conditioner Hose Pipes in HVAC Systems


Air conditioning systems are essential for maintaining comfortable indoor environments, particularly in regions with extreme temperatures. While most people are familiar with the primary components of air conditioning units—such as compressors, evaporators, and condensers—they often overlook the significance of air conditioner hose pipes. These pipes play a crucial role in the overall efficiency and functionality of HVAC systems, and understanding their importance can help homeowners and professionals alike make informed decisions about maintenance and upgrades.


Air conditioner hose pipes are typically used to transport refrigerant between different components of the system, such as the indoor and outdoor units. These hoses are designed to handle high-pressure refrigerants, ensuring optimal heat exchange during the cooling process. A robust and well-functioning hose system is essential for the efficient operation of an air conditioning unit. If the hoses are damaged or worn out, they can lead to refrigerant leaks, significantly affecting the system's performance.


One of the most common issues associated with air conditioner hose pipes is degradation over time. Factors such as exposure to sunlight, extreme temperatures, and general wear and tear can contribute to the deterioration of these hoses. Consequently, it is vital for homeowners to conduct regular inspections of their HVAC system and pay close attention to the condition of the air conditioner hose pipes. Signs of wear might include cracks, bulges, or discoloration. If any of these issues are detected, it is advisable to replace the hoses immediately to prevent further damage to the system.

In addition to physical wear, air conditioner hose pipes can also become clogged with debris or contaminants. This can impede the flow of refrigerant, leading to decreased efficiency and increased energy consumption. To mitigate this risk, regular maintenance is essential. Homeowners should schedule routine servicing with a qualified HVAC technician, who can clean and inspect the entire air conditioning system, including the hose pipes. This proactive approach helps maintain optimal performance and extends the lifespan of the equipment.


Another critical aspect to consider when dealing with air conditioner hose pipes is insulation. Properly insulated hose pipes can help reduce energy loss and enhance the overall efficiency of the system. Poor insulation can lead to condensation, which can contribute to mold growth and other moisture-related issues. Ensuring that the hose pipes are well insulated not only improves energy efficiency but also promotes a healthier indoor air quality.


Furthermore, during installation or replacement of air conditioner hose pipes, it's essential to choose high-quality materials. Many options are available, including rubber, polyurethane, and aluminum. Each material has its pros and cons, and the choice will depend on the specific requirements of the HVAC system and the environment in which it operates. Consulting with a knowledgeable HVAC professional can help ensure that the right type of hose is selected for optimal performance.


In conclusion, air conditioner hose pipes may not be the most glamorous components of an HVAC system, but their importance cannot be overstated. They are fundamental in maintaining refrigerant flow, ensuring efficient heat exchange, and ultimately providing the cooling comfort that homeowners rely on. Regular inspections, timely replacements, and proper insulation can significantly extend the life of these hoses and improve overall system performance. By paying attention to this often-overlooked aspect of air conditioning maintenance, homeowners can ensure that their systems run smoothly and efficiently for years to come.
